Key Insights
The Intravenous Immunoglobulin (IVIG) market, valued at approximately $XX million in 2025, is projected to experience robust growth, ex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.31%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is driven by several key factors. The rising prevalence of primary and secondary immunodeficiency disorders, coupled with an aging global population more susceptible to these conditions, fuels significant demand for IVIG therapy. Furthermore, advancements in manufacturing processes leading to higher purity and efficacy of IVIG products, along with increasing awareness among healthcare professionals and patients about the benefits of IVIG treatment, are contributing to market growth. The intravenous route of administration currently dominates the market, but subcutaneous delivery systems are emerging as a promising alternative, offering improved patient convenience and reduced healthcare costs. Geographic variations exist, with North America and Europe currently holding the largest market shares due to higher healthcare expenditure and established healthcare infrastructure. However, emerging economies in Asia-Pacific and other regions are expected to demonstrate significant growth potential in the coming years, driven by increasing disposable incomes and improved healthcare access.
The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of established multinational pharmaceutical companies and emerging regional players. Key players like Kedrion Biopharma Inc, CSL Ltd, Eli Lilly, and Octapharma AG are heavily invested in research and development, focusing on innovative formulations, improved delivery systems, and expanding their global reach. Strategic partnerships, mergers and acquisitions, and increased investment in clinical trials are anticipated to shape the competitive dynamics of the market. While the market faces certain challenges, such as high treatment costs that can limit accessibility, particularly in low- and middle-income countries, these are partially mitigated by ongoing efforts to improve affordability and insurance coverage. The increasing focus on personalized medicine and targeted therapies also presents opportunities for future innovation within the IVIG market.

Key Markets & Segments Leading Intravenous Immunoglobulin (IVIG) Market
The IVIG market exhibits diverse growth patterns across different segments and regions.
By Mode of Delivery: The intravenous route dominates the market, accounting for the majority of sales. However, the subcutaneous delivery segment is exhibiting substantial growth due to the increasing demand for patient convenience and home-based treatment options.
By Application: Hypogammaglobulinemia holds the largest share due to its high prevalence. Other significant applications include Chronic Inflammatory Demyelinating Polyneuropathy (CIDP), Immunodeficiency Disease, and Myasthenia Gravis.
By Product: IgG is the dominant product type, accounting for the largest proportion of the market, owing to its wide range of therapeutic applications.
Dominant Regions: North America and Europe currently hold significant market shares, primarily due to high healthcare spending and well-established healthcare infrastructure. However, emerging markets in Asia-Pacific are expected to witness strong growth in the coming years due to rising disposable incomes and increasing awareness of immunodeficiency disorders.

Key Milestones in Intravenous Immunoglobulin (IVIG) Market Industry
- March 2022: Grifols received approval for XEMBIFY, a subcutaneous immunoglobulin (SCIG) in several European Union member states and the United Kingdom, expanding treatment options for immunodeficiencies.
- April 2023: Everest Medicines received approval for Nefecon, an IgAN drug, in China, expanding treatment options for immunoglobulin A nephropathy.
